Plot Romolo - Cattolica Eraclea Open, panoramic and ten minutes from the sea, Plot Romolo covers more than 13,000 m² of buildable land near Cattolica Eraclea. The setting is Sicily's quiet south-west coast, in the province of Agrigento. A House of 120 to 130 m² Facing the Sea The plot carries a building entitlement under Sicily's rules for agricultural land. This allows a home of roughly 120 to 130 m² plus rural outbuildings tied to the use of the ground. The exact size and design must be confirmed by a technician, who will check the local rules, restrictions and permits. The ground is mostly level or gently sloping, at around 140 metres above sea level, facing south and west. A single-storey house with wide openings and shaded verandas would make the most of the sea view. There would be space left over for a Mediterranean garden, cultivated areas and, where authorised, a pool. Setting up the Amenities An internal track is already traced and follows the natural shape of the land. The approach runs along a good state road, with only a short unsurfaced stretch at the end. Mains electricity is close by thanks to a neighbouring house, and if you want to stay green there is obviously more than enough land to install an independent photovoltaic system. Water can come from a well, subject to permits, or a tanker-filled cistern of the kind widely used on rural properties. Drainage would use an approved independent system. The Beach of Eraclea Minoa and the Platani Nature Reserve The beach and pine wood at Eraclea Minoa are about ten minutes by car. The sands run beneath the white cliffs of Capo Bianco and the archaeological area of the ancient Greek town. The nature reserve at the mouth of the River Platani adds dunes and quiet shoreline. Cattolica Eraclea, 10 to 15 minutes away, covers daily services. Sciacca is around 35 minutes and Agrigento with its Valley of the Temples about 40. The airports at Palermo and Trapani are each roughly two and a quarter hours.
